Position Overview
Assist the District Manager in the growth and profitability of the district operations while providing leadership, vision, support, and enforcement of company policies for all operations within the district and market served. This role involves performing the following duties.
Job Duties
- Work as a tree care specialist making house calls.
- Educate residential and commercial customers on the needs of their trees.
- Provide customers with estimates based on their needs.
- Develop and update annual plant health care programs.
- Create and build relationships with new and existing clients.
- Set up, supervise, and train crew members, sales team, and office staff.
- Assist the District Manager in directing the team as part of the office management team.
Qualifications
- ISA Certified Arborist
- Valid driver’s license
- Regional plant and horticulture knowledge
- Good people skills; self-motivated; computer proficient and organized
- Knowledge and experience with tree care, hazard tree evaluation, integrated pest management, and industry-approved practices
- Preferred:
Relevant pesticide and related licenses and certificates, if required by state law - Preferred:
Two or four-year degree in a green industry

The Davey Tree Expert Company operates in over 47 states and five provinces in the US and Canada, providing tree care, grounds maintenance, and consulting services for residential, utility, commercial, and government clients. Founded in 1880, Davey has been employee-owned for 40 years and employs over 10,000 staff delivering Proven Solutions for a Growing World. For more information, visit
